Large shares of β€œnones” in some countries say β€œthere is something spiritual beyond the natural world, even if we cannot see it.” For instance, 61% of β€œnones” in Mexico and 65% in Brazil express this belief.

Many religiously unaffiliated adults also express belief in God. This includes solid majorities of β€œnones” in South Africa (77%) and several countries in Latin America, such as Brazil (92%), Colombia (86%) and Chile (69%).3

Religiously unaffiliated adults in Europe and Australia are much less inclined to believe in God. Just 18% of β€œnones” in Australia, 10% in Sweden and 9% in Hungary are believers.

In the United States, 45% of β€œnones” say they believe in God, according to our 2023 survey.

Another relatively common belief among people who do not affiliate with any religion is that animals can have spirits or spiritual energies. In Greece and several Latin American countries, at least three-quarters of β€œnones” believe this.

In general, β€œnones” are somewhat more likely to say they pray than to say they light incense or candles. However, in most of the studied countries, the β€œnones” who pray tend to report that they do so infrequently – a few times a month or less often.

For example, just 23% of German β€œnones” say they ever pray. That includes 16% who pray a few times a month or less often, and 7% who say they pray weekly or more often.

Overall, β€œnones” are much less likely than religiously affiliated adults to engage in these practices. For instance, 72% of Christians in Germany say they ever pray, including 33% who pray at least weekly.

Many β€œnones” express negative views about religion’s influence on society.

For instance, in 12 of the 22 countries studied here, religiously unaffiliated adults are more likely to say religion encourages intolerance than to say it encourages tolerance. In Germany, nearly three-quarters of β€œnones” say religion encourages intolerance, compared with a quarter who say it encourages tolerance.

Nursing homes face 10 percent rate cut as states begin to grapple with federal Medicaid rollbacks Providers are facing a 10% decline in state reimbursement as NC leaders grapple with a $319 million Medicaid shortfall.

North Carolina proposes 10% cuts in Medicaid payments to nursing homes in the wake of the reconciliation bill. Nationwide, Medicaid pays for 63% of long-term nursing home stays. Four out of five *middle-class* people who need care >5 years will go on Medicaid.
